These EECs are classified based on the hormones they produce, such as serotonin-producing enterochromaffin cells (ECs), cholecystokini (CCK)-producing I-cells, GIP-producing K-cells, GLP-1 producing L-cells, somatostatin (SST)-producing D-cells, neurotensin (NTS)-producing N-cells, secretin (SCT)-producing S-cells and ghrelin (GHRL)-producing X cells
